What a custom software development company actually does
A custom software development company takes responsibility for a working system, from the first conversation about what the business needs through to software running in production. That's the whole job, and it's worth stating plainly because the category has blurred at both edges.
At one edge sit staffing firms that place engineers into your team. You direct the work, you own the architecture, and you carry the risk if the thing doesn't ship. At the other edge sit product companies selling configurable software that you adapt your process to. A development company sits between the two: it owns the delivery of something that didn't exist before, built to fit a process you're not willing to change.
The scope usually covers discovery and requirements, technical architecture, product and interface design, engineering across whatever surfaces the product needs, quality assurance, deployment, and a maintenance phase after launch. Firms differ enormously in how much of that they genuinely do in-house versus subcontract, and that difference rarely appears on the services page.
How a custom software development company differs from a staffing agency
The difference is accountability, not headcount. A staffing agency is paid for hours worked and hands you the risk of what those hours produce; if the architecture is wrong, that's your problem. A custom software development company is paid for a system that works, which means the estimating risk, the architectural decisions, and the consequences of getting either wrong sit on its side of the contract.
Worth separating from adjacent categories: a firm that only supplies people is doing staff augmentation, and a firm that delivers a defined scope for a fixed outcome is doing software development outsourcing. Both labels get printed on the same business cards. The contract tells you which one you're actually buying.
How we picked these custom software development companies
We applied four tests, and a firm had to pass all four.
First, verifiability. Founding year, headquarters, and any claim about certification, listing, or scale had to appear on the company's own website or in a named publication we could open. Directory profiles on review sites didn't count, because those are self-submitted and rarely maintained.
Second, evidence of current operation in 2026. A live site with current content, active hiring, or a dated recent announcement.
Third, a genuine custom development practice rather than a product company with a services arm, or a marketing agency that added engineering to its menu.
Fourth, something distinguishable. Every firm here has an attribute you can point at: a stock listing, a formal certification, an ownership structure, a delivery model. Ten companies that all describe themselves as an end-to-end digital transformation partner would be a useless list.
Two firms from our earlier version came out on the first test. We could not confirm their basics against their own sites, and a name we can't stand behind is worse for you than a shorter list. The ordering below runs from largest to smallest by headcount where headcount is published. It's a scale ladder, and reading it as a quality ranking would be a mistake we're trying hard to prevent.

1. Thoughtworks
Thoughtworks is the global technology consultancy on this list, founded in 1993 in Chicago and describing itself as blending design, engineering, and AI expertise. Its own about page puts its scale at more than 10,000 people across 47 offices in 18 countries, which makes it an order of magnitude larger than anything else here.
The fact worth knowing in 2026 is a structural one. Thoughtworks traded on NASDAQ under the ticker TWKS until 2024, when Apax Funds took it private in a deal valued at roughly 1.75 billion dollars at 4.40 dollars per share. The company's own newsroom confirms the transaction completed on 13 November 2024 and that its shares no longer trade publicly. For a buyer, private-equity ownership is neither good nor bad on its own, but it changes the incentives around margin and staffing that shape how a firm this size prices work.
Thoughtworks fits enterprise programmes: multi-year modernization, work spanning several business units, procurement processes that require a vendor of a certain size. It's not the economical choice for a single product, and it doesn't pretend to be.
2. Simform
Simform describes itself as a digital product engineering firm covering cloud, AI, and data, founded in 2010. Its about page claims more than 1,200 employees and 350 or more platform-certified engineers, which puts it in the large multi-region tier without the consultancy overhead of Thoughtworks.
Its most concrete credential is on the Microsoft side: Simform publishes its status as a Microsoft Solutions Partner and an Azure Expert MSP, a designation Microsoft awards after an audit rather than a self-declaration. If your build is landing on Azure, that's a meaningful signal.
One honest observation. Simform doesn't state a headquarters city anywhere we could find on its own site, describing its footprint only as multiple headquarters. That's unusual for a firm of its size, and it's the kind of thing worth asking about directly, because knowing which legal entity you're contracting with matters more than most buyers realize until something goes wrong.

4. STX Next
STX Next was born in March 2005 in Poznan, Poland, and its site says so in those words. It now describes itself as a global IT consulting company and AI powerhouse with nearly 500 professionals, built on a Python heritage that goes back to its founding.
What sets it apart on this list is documented security posture. STX Next publishes ISO/IEC 27001 and TISAX certification alongside GDPR compliance, and lists AWS Advanced Tier Consulting Partner status plus Snowflake and Databricks partnerships. For regulated work, a formal information security certification is one of the few credentials in this industry that means something specific, because it's audited by a third party against a published standard.
Worth a correction if you have read older material: STX Next's own site describes growing to 330 people by 2020. That's a historical milestone, not current scale. The present figure it publishes is close to 500.
5. Vincit
Vincit is the only firm on this list you can look up on a stock exchange. Founded in 2007 in Finland, with offices across Tampere, Helsinki, Turku, Oulu, Jyvaskyla, and Kuopio, it describes itself as combining enterprise platforms, AI solutions, and human-centric design, at a scale of roughly 500 people and partners.
Its investor site states that Vincit's shares are listed on Nasdaq First North Growth Market Finland, the growth segment operated by Nasdaq Helsinki rather than the main regulated list. That distinction matters for how you read the disclosure: First North issuers publish less than main-market issuers, but they publish more than any private agency. Vincit released a half-year report for the first half of 2026, which is about as clear a proof of current operation as this list contains.
For a buyer, a listed vendor means financial statements you can read before signing. In a category where most firms disclose nothing, that's a real advantage worth weighing.

Five kinds of software development firm, and which fits your build
The most useful thing you can do before shortlisting is decide which archetype you need, because the ten firms above aren't competing with each other in any meaningful sense. A 10,000-person consultancy and a 40-person studio rarely appear in the same procurement process, and when they do, one of them is wasting its time.
| Archetype | Typical scale | Fits | What you trade |
|---|---|---|---|
| Global consultancy | Thousands | Multi-year enterprise programmes, organizational change | Highest rates, account layers between you and engineers |
| Large multi-region firm | 500 to 2,000 | Parallel workstreams, broad technology coverage | Variable seniority, who you meet is not always who builds |
| European mid-size studio | 200 to 500 | Serious products needing certification and process | Less bench depth for sudden scale-ups |
| Senior boutique | Under 150 | One focused product, senior throughout | Limited capacity, cannot absorb a second parallel programme |
| Nearshore or distributed | Varies | Time zone overlap at a lower cost base | Contracting entity may sit in a different country from the team |
The trade in the right-hand column is the part buyers skip. Every archetype gives something up, and a firm claiming to give up nothing is describing its marketing rather than its operations.
Two practical rules follow. If your build is one product with a clear owner, the boutique and mid-size tiers will almost always deliver faster and cheaper than a consultancy, because there's no bench to keep busy and no account management layer to fund. If your build touches procurement, legal, several departments, and a change programme, the consultancy premium buys coordination you would otherwise have to supply yourself. How to evaluate a custom software development company
Evaluate a custom software development company on seven checks, each of which has a factual answer the firm either gives you or doesn't.
Seven checks for any custom software development company
Who writes the code. Ask whether the engineers in the sales conversation are the ones assigned to your project, and ask for their names. The gap between the presented team and the delivered team is the oldest problem in this industry and the easiest to test for.
Production evidence in your problem domain. Not logos, and not a portfolio of screens. Ask for a system in production with a comparable integration surface or compliance load, and ask what went wrong on it. A firm that can't name a difficulty has either not shipped much or isn't being straight with you.
Security and ownership, in writing. Who owns the code and the IP, what happens to it if the engagement ends, how the firm handles credentials and data, and whether it holds a third-party certification such as ISO 27001. Four of the ten firms above publish a formal certification, and two of those have around a hundred people. Certification is achievable well below enterprise scale, so its absence is a choice rather than a constraint.
What the estimate is based on. An estimate produced before any discovery is a sales number. A fixed price after a paid discovery is an engineering number. The distinction is worth more than any discount, and it's the single strongest predictor of whether the final invoice resembles the first one.
How progress is reported. Weekly working software beats a status document. Ask what you'll see in week two, and what you'll be able to click.
What happens after launch. Custom software is a living system, and the maintenance phase is where most of its lifetime cost sits. Ask who supports it, at what response time, and whether it's the same engineers.
How AI is used in the build. This one is new, and it's now the most revealing question on the list. Ask specifically where AI sits in the workflow and what the review discipline around it looks like. A firm that says it doesn't use AI is either behind or not telling you. A firm that can't describe its review loop is a genuine risk.
The reason this framework matters is measurable. The McKinsey and Oxford study of more than 5,400 IT projects found large ones running 45 percent over budget and 7 percent over time, delivering 56 percent less value than predicted, with 17 percent going badly enough to threaten the company's existence. Vendor selection isn't the only cause of that, but it's the variable you control before signing anything.
Engagement models and what a custom software development agency charges
Pricing in this category isn't opaque because firms are hiding something. It's opaque because the number depends on a scope that doesn't exist yet. What you can pin down before then is the engagement model, and the model decides who carries the risk when the estimate turns out to be wrong.
| Model | Who carries estimating risk | You manage | Fits |
|---|---|---|---|
| Fixed scope after discovery | The vendor | Acceptance against the spec | A first release with a defined outcome |
| Time and materials | You | Priorities, week to week | A live product with shifting requirements |
| Dedicated team | Shared | Direction; the vendor runs the squad | A long roadmap needing continuity |
| Staff augmentation | You | Day-to-day work and architecture | An in-house team with specific gaps |
Rates are built on salaries, so regional wage data is the honest anchor. The U.S. Bureau of Labor Statistics recorded a median annual wage of 132,270 dollars for software developers in May 2023, with the 90th percentile at 208,620 dollars and a mean hourly wage of 66.40 dollars. Any US firm's rate card starts above that and adds overhead, benefits, non-billable time, and margin. European rates sit lower, which is the entire economic basis for the Polish and Baltic firms on this list, and Eurostat counted 10.45 million ICT specialists across the EU in 2025, 5 percent of everyone employed, so the supply is genuinely deep rather than a marketing claim.
What has changed is why companies buy. Deloitte's Global Outsourcing Survey, covering more than 500 business and technology leaders, found cost reduction cited as the primary driver by 34 percent of organizations in 2024, down from 48 percent in 2022 and 70 percent in 2020. Improved access to talent came first at 42 percent. The same survey found 92 percent of organizations using or planning to use AI in service delivery, and 83 percent expecting third-party vendors to bring AI capabilities with them.
That reordering should change how you negotiate. If you're optimizing purely for rate, you're optimizing for the thing buyers have collectively decided matters least. What AI changed about custom software development
AI changed the cost basis of custom software, and the firms that adapted are quietly quoting differently from the ones that haven't.
Start with adoption, because it's now close to universal. Stack Overflow's 2025 Developer Survey, with more than 49,000 responses from 177 countries, found 84 percent of developers using or planning to use AI tools, up from 76 percent the prior year. Google Cloud's 2025 DORA research put 90 percent of respondents using AI at work with more than 80 percent believing it increased their productivity. JetBrains surveyed 24,534 developers across 194 countries and found 85 percent regularly using AI tools, with nearly nine in ten saving at least an hour a week.
The measured effect on individual tasks is large. GitHub's controlled study of 95 professional developers found those using Copilot completed a task 55 percent faster, averaging 1 hour 11 minutes against 2 hours 41 minutes, with a higher completion rate.
Now the part vendors don't lead with. Stack Overflow found more developers actively distrust the accuracy of AI tools, 46 percent, than trust it, at 33 percent, with only 3 percent reporting high trust. DORA found 30 percent reporting little or no trust in AI-generated code. So the profession has adopted the tools nearly universally while remaining sceptical of their output, and that gap is precisely where the review discipline lives.
This is why the AI question belongs in your evaluation rather than in the vendor's pitch deck. The productivity gain is real and measured. It converts into a good product only when someone senior reads what the model produced. Red flags to check before you sign with a software development firm
Some warning signs show up before the contract does, and they are cheap to check.
A price quoted before any discovery. If a firm can name a number for a system it hasn't scoped, the number is a marketing device and the change requests are already planned.
No named engineers. If you can't get the names and backgrounds of the people who will build your product, you're buying a team you haven't met.
Vagueness about code ownership. This should be one sentence in the contract. Hesitation here is a serious signal, and it's easy to test early.
A portfolio of logos with no systems behind them. Logos prove someone paid an invoice. Ask what was built, what it integrated with, and what broke.
Certification claims with no issuer. ISO 27001 is issued by a named certification body against a published standard. Merixstudio names TUV NORD Polska; STX Next names its standards explicitly. A firm that claims certification without naming who issued it is doing something else.
No maintenance answer. Most of a system's lifetime cost arrives after launch. A firm without a clear support model hasn't thought past the invoice, and the difference between a vendor and a long-term development partner shows up exactly here.
The reason these checks work is that the answers are all factual. A firm either names its engineers or doesn't, either holds a certification or doesn't, either scopes before pricing or doesn't. You're not judging enthusiasm. You're collecting statements that turn out to be true or false, and the ones that come back vague have already told you what you needed to know.
